6.) Did Magellan make it all the way around the world?

Answers

Answer:

No

Explanation:

He died on 27 April 1521 on Mactan Island, Cebu, Philippines. He had masterminded the first expedition to sail around the world but he didn't complete the voyage.

PLEASE HELP!!!!! How did Europeans in North America negatively impact Native Americans?
Give at least two examples to support your answer.

Answers

Answer:

Europeans exposed Native Americans to disease and traded them lethal weaponry to use in their tribal wars.

Explanation:

1) Europeans carried new diseases, like measles, to North America by which natives had no immunity, killing them in large numbers.

2) Europeans traded Native Americans muskets for animal products and tobacco, making inter-tribal warfare far more lethal, because guns are more dangerous than traditional weaponry.
